5304496526 Frigidaire Control Panel is a user-interface and electronic control assembly used on compatible Frigidaire household appliances. The assembly typically combines the tactile or capacitive keypad, status indicators or display moduleand a printed circuit subassembly into a single replaceable panel. Mechanically it provides the front-facing housing and connector interfaces required to mount the electronics and link them to the appliance wiring harness.
Functionally, the control panel translates operator inputs into electrical signals and communicates those signals to the appliance’s main control/logic board while presenting status and error details back to the user. It commonly interfaces with power-supply lines, sensor inputs (temperature, door/lid switches), and actuator control circuits (relays, motor starts, valves) via ribbon cables or multi-pin connectors. The panel can contain input scanning circuitry, display drivers and passive components that require proper voltage references, grounding and reliable connector mating to maintain correct operation and to avoid intermittent faults.

Functional Role and Electrical Interfaces of the Control panel Assembly
The 5304496526 Frigidaire control Panel serves as the user interface and low-voltage signal translator between the consumer controls and the appliance’s main control board. Electrically, the assembly accepts a regulated supply from the main board, scans a keypad matrix or membrane switches, drives display segments and indicator ledsand presents discrete control signals (logic-level outputs or pulse commands) to downstream relays, triacsor inverter drives. On many machines the panel also implements a simple serial or parallel communication link to the main controller for configuration,fault reporting,and back‑light control; understanding those signal types and their voltage/ground references is essential when diagnosing intermittent behavior or replacing the part.
Compatibility depends on matching connector pinout, signal voltage levelsand expected firmware/command protocol rather than just mechanical fit.Technicians replacing a panel shoudl verify harness color codes and pin functions with a multimeter or wiring diagram and confirm that the panel’s ground and supply rails are present before applying power. Practical checks include measuring the panel supply voltage, probing keypad row/column activity during key pressesand monitoring communication lines with a logic analyzer to confirm command traffic; when transferring an old bezel or ribbon, ensure mating connectors are fully seated and retention clips engaged to avoid contact resistance or intermittent faults.

How the 5304496526 Frigidaire Control Panel Communicates with Sensors, User Inputsand the Main PCB
The 5304496526 Frigidaire Control Panel contains a front-end microcontroller and interface circuitry that translates user actions and any local sensor conditioning into signals the main PCB can interpret. The panel receives a low-voltage supply and ground from the main board and implements keypad scanning, debounce logicand display/LED drive locally; it then communicates encoded button events and status information back to the main PCB via dedicated signal lines or a simple serial/data protocol. Analog sensor inputs (such as, a thermistor) can be routed through the panel as conditioned voltages or converted to digital values depending on whether the panel or the main board performs the ADC conversion, so matching the expected signal type is essential for compatibility.
- Keypad matrix scanning or touch-controller reporting for user inputs
- Local LED/display drive with status and fault indication
- Low-voltage digital communication (discrete lines or short packet serial) to the main PCB
- Conditioning or forwarding of sensor signals (analog or digital)
- Diagnostic/status signalling to assist fault detection on the main board
In practise the panel packages user commands into brief messages or toggles control lines while the main PCB retains duty for high-voltage switching and overall system logic; this split reduces wiring complexity and keeps the user interface at safe voltages. For troubleshooting, check the harness for correct Vcc and ground, verify continuity of data/control conductors, and observe activity with a logic probe or oscilloscope during a button press to confirm expected communication. When replacing the part, ensure the replacement matches the harness pinout, signal voltage levelsand firmware generation of the main PCB-mismatches can produce symptoms such as unresponsive buttons, incorrect temperature readingsor a blank display despite correct power to the panel.

Common Failure Symptoms, Error Codes and Signal-Level Diagnostic Indicators
The 5304496526 Frigidaire Control Panel is the user interface assembly that translates keypad presses into digital commands and provides the display and status feedback for the appliance. Common failure symptoms include a blank or partially lit display, scrambled or missing segments, unresponsive membrane keys, intermittent operation (functions start or stop without user input)and displayed error codes or flashing patterns that indicate internal faults. These behaviors moast frequently enough arise from degraded ribbon cable contacts, failed backlight or VCC regulators on the module, corrosion at connector pins, or faults within the panel’s microcontroller or keypad matrix rather than the appliance’s power or heating elements; confirming panel compatibility with the oven model and verifying connector pinouts before replacement reduces misdiagnosis and unnecessary swaps.
- Blank or dim display – check display backlight supply and VCC at the panel connector.
- Unresponsive or sticky keys - inspect membrane switches, cleaningor replace if worn; test keypad matrix continuity.
- Intermittent relays/cycle behavior with correct UI – suspect intermittent data/ground at the panel harness.
- Error codes or flashing sequences – record pattern and compare to service manual; verify sensor inputs and communications lines.
| Item | description |
|---|---|
| 0 V at VCC | No logic power – probable blown fuse, failed regulator, or harness open; verify upstream power and connector continuity. |
| ~3.0-3.6 V (digital rail) | Normal MCU logic level on modern panels; if present but no display or response, suspect MCU, firmware corruptionor keypad traces. |
| ~11-13 V (backlight/relay supply) | Typical range for backlight or relay coil drivers; reduced voltage indicates failing regulator or excessive loading on the supply. |
For practical diagnostics use a multimeter to check VCC and ground at the panel connector first, then verify key data lines for pulse activity with a logic probe or scope while exercising keys or starting a cycle. If VCC rails are within the expected ranges but the display is blank or keys are ignored, inspect the flat flex cable and connector for bent pins or contamination and consider thermal or mechanical stress points (solder joints, connector clips). documenting the exact error code or blink pattern and matching it to service documentation will guide whether the fault is panel-local or caused by external inputs such as a shorted sensor or communication failure.
Replacement Considerations: Compatibility, Mechanical Fitment and Installation Procedures for the Control Panel
The 5304496526 Frigidaire Control Panel is the user interface assembly that houses the display, switches or membrane keys, and the PCB-to-harness connections.Replacement compatibility depends on more than visual fit: the electrical interface (connector type, pin count, signal pinout and any keyed orientation), the PCB mounting and bezel geometry, and the mechanical retention features such as studs, clips and screw locations. A panel that looks identical can still be electrically incompatible – such as, two panels may share bezel dimensions but use different ribbon cable pinouts or keyed connectors, which will produce a blank display or nonfunctional keys if installed without verification.
- Confirm OEM part number and cross-reference to the specific appliance model.
- Compare connector pin count, keyed shapes and ribbon orientation before disconnecting the original.
- Measure mounting hole locations, bezel depth and button/sensor alignment to ensure mechanical fit.
- Label harness connections and take photos before removal to preserve wiring order.
- Plan a bench or in-situ functional check after installation (power rails, LEDs, button response).
| Item | Description |
|---|---|
| Connector | Verify type (ribbon, Molex, JST), pin count and keyed orientation to prevent mismatches. |
| Mounting | Compare screw/stud locations and bezel profile to avoid stress on PCB and trim pieces. |
| Pre-install checks | Label harnesses, inspect for bent pinsand confirm supply voltages before full power-up. |
Follow proven installation procedures: isolate mains power, remove retaining hardware while supporting the assembly to avoid bending or tearing the ribbon cableand disconnect connectors only after labeling or photographing positions. When installing the replacement, align keyed connectors, seat ribbon cables fully and lock any retention clips; verify VCC and ground with a meter at the panel connector before applying full power. After installation perform a functional checkout using the unit’s diagnostic mode or a short run cycle to confirm display illumination, indicators and all key inputs; common post-replacement symptoms-intermittent keys, no displayor partial LED function-are usually corrected by reseating the ribbon, correcting connector orientation, or relieving mechanical stress on the PCB from misaligned mounting.
Q&A
What is part number 5304496526 for a Frigidaire appliance?
Part 5304496526 is a frigidaire control panel/console assembly (the user interface and associated electronics) used on certain Frigidaire ranges/ovens. It contains the touchpad or buttons, display, and the board(s) that process user inputs. Always confirm compatibility by matching your appliance model number (found on the rating plate inside the oven door frame, behind the drawer, or on the back of the range) to a parts list or the vendor’s compatibility chart before ordering.
What are common symptoms that indicate the 5304496526 control panel is failing?
Typical symptoms include an unresponsive or intermittently responding keypad/touchpad, blank or garbled display, random or phantom key presses, oven functions not starting despite correct settings, persistent error codes related to the user interface, visible burning or scorch marks on the boardor the appliance only working when you jostle the console. These signs point to a failing control panel but can also be caused by wiring or power problems.
How can I troubleshoot to be sure the control panel (5304496526) is the problem?
Start with basic checks: verify the appliance has proper mains power and the circuit breaker/fuse is OK.Inspect the panel and wiring harness for visible damage or burnt connectors. Check for error codes and consult the service manual. With the power disconnected, ensure ribbon/signal cables are fully seated.With appropriate electrical skills and precautions, measure incoming voltage at the control board connector (when powered) and check continuity of the keypad membrane if accessible. Also test related components (oven sensor, heating elements, door switches) as they can produce symptoms that mimic a bad console.If you’re unsure or not pleasant working on mains-powered equipment, hire a qualified technician.
how do I replace the 5304496526 control panel safely?
Basic replacement steps (high level): 1) Disconnect power to the appliance at the breaker. 2) Remove screws/fasteners securing the console (frequently enough at the back of the range or under trim). 3) Carefully tilt or lift the console forward and locate/disconnect wiring harnesses and any grounding wires.4) Transfer any needed insulation or brackets to the new console. 5) Install the new control panel, reconnect harnesses, secure fasteners, and restore power. After installation, test all functions. Important safety notes: always disconnect power before opening the appliance, avoid touching exposed circuitry when poweredand if you’re unsure about electrical connections, use a licensed appliance technician.
Will I need to program or calibrate the new control panel after installation?
Most replacements require only basic setup like setting the clock and preferred defaults. Some Frigidaire consoles perform a self-test or need a simple keypad sequence to enter diagnostics; consult the appliance’s service manual for model-specific steps. Oven temperature calibration (if needed) is usually done via the oven control or by adjusting the oven sensor, not the user panel itself. If the oven requires a specific calibration or configuration after board replacement, the service manual will list the procedure.
Can the 5304496526 control panel be repaired rather of replaced?
Minor problems (worn keypad membrane, loose connectoror a single failed component) can sometimes be repaired by a qualified electronics technician. Repair options include replacing the membrane keypad, replacing small burned componentsor repairing traces. Though, many technicians recommend replacement as control panels are relatively inexpensiveand repairs can be time-consuming and may not be durable. Repairs also require skill working with mains-voltage electronics and risk of damaging the new panel if done incorrectly.
